I wear full armored leather(zip together suit if you will), over the ankle MC boots, leather/kevlar/ceramic gloves, full face helmet and a rather large backpack. I structure my ride so that I don't sit still. I *think* I could manage with just a bike nowadays, ever since the doc cleared me for bike duty I have only driven my car once and that was just to start it and make sure nothing goes dead.
Perforated leathers do a good job in keeping you well ventialted, only place that does not get a good breeze is the back of my legs and arse. If I open up the vents on the chest and arms of my Core jacket my back is bathed in sweet, sweet cool refreshing air.
